Operation principle

The function can be enabled and disabled with the Operation setting. The
corresponding parameter values are "on" and "off".
The operation of CCSPVC can be described with a module diagram. All the modules
in the diagram are explained in the next sections.

Differential current monitoring
Differential current monitoring supervises the difference between the summed phase
currents I_A, I_B and I_C and the reference current I_REF.
The current operating characteristics can be selected with the Start value setting.
When the highest phase current is less than 1.0 × In, the differential current limit is
defined with Start value. When the highest phase current is more than 1.0 × In, the
differential current limit is calculated with the equation.
